DOOR WITH NO NAME (1951) / DOORWAY TO DANGER (1952-53)
------------------------------------------------------
NBC
Produced by Walter Selden
US Spy Drama Series Summers 1951, 1952, 1953
"Door With No Name"
Starring:
Melville Ruick as Chief John Randolph, Secret Agent
(1951)
Grant Richards as Agent Doug Carter (1951)
"Doorway To Danger"
Starring:
Roland Winters as Chief John Randolph, Secret Agent
(1952-53)
Stacy Harris as Agent Doug Carter (1952-53)
Narrated by: Westbrook Van Vorhis
Announcer: Ernest Chapell
